Peter Lichtenbaum advises clients on a broad array of international regulatory compliance and trade matters, including export controls, economic sanctions, national security reviews of foreign investments, anti-corruption laws, market access, and international trade disputes. He has specialized experience in the aerospace and defense industries.

Mr. Lichtenbaum is ranked in Band 1 for Export Controls & Sanctions in Chambers USA (2019), which reports that he is one of those rare lawyers who thinks through all the options moving forward. Chambers describes him as a go-to lawyer for those with export controls and sanctions issues.

Mr. Lichtenbaum has recently helped several companies establish, review or enhance their compliance programs. He is advising major technology companies regarding the impact of recent and ongoing export control developments on their businesses. He has worked with many leading aerospace and defense companies on internal investigations and disclosures related to trade controls and China. He also advises many of these companies on export control reform and defense trade policy issues, including international agreements on the regulation of defense trade. He has extensive experience with the trade controls issues that arise in the U.S. system for national security review of foreign investment, helping companies to identify issues and mitigate government concerns.
